The Basics:

The word “Inteha” is a word taken from the Urdu Language. Its literal meaning is “The Extreme.” It can also be used as a synonym for “Conclusion”, thus forming the opposite of the term Ibteda which means the beginning. It has more relaxed colloquial implications to its usage which can include a spectrum of terms like “Limits”, “Boundaries” and “Excellent”. Its usage therefore can include a diversity of expression and variety of meaning. The Origins:

“Inteha” was born in the bedroom of a teenager, in a red, brick town house in Islamia Park, Lahore. Nausher Javed had a heart full of dreams, a mind full of ideas and a handful of chords on a keyboard gifted to him by his parents. Endowed with a mind indigenous to the finer workings of musical details, he set out to teach himself and then master the art of basics and progressions. He was constantly churning out tunes in modes varying from Spanish pop to Techno metal and making home recordings for his friends to awe upon and rave about. Everyone who heard his music somehow believed that he would go places with this gift. In the meantime, in another bedroom of a red, brick in Islamia Park that ironically belonged to the same house mentioned above, another teenager was humming tunes to himself. Naukhez Javed always knew about his younger brother as a budding musical exponent, but kept his own talent under wraps till later. After a few tries of forming a band with some college friends, Nausher stumbled on the right kind of vocalist for his music in his own house. It seemed as if Naukhez’s voice was tailor made for Nausher’s all out style of rock. It took them a little while to decide how they wanted to define their sound, but once they defined themselves, they only headed in one direction, vertically oriented and directed skyward. Inteha released their first single, Dastaan in February 2005. The single took FM stations all across the country by storm. A video was released accompanying the single that further rocketed their popularity via Indus Music and The Musik channels. Inteha was nominated and voted as the new band of the year on FM 89 and Dastaan remained a chart topper for many weeks there. Another single Anjana was released shortly after Dastaan and it enjoyed equal popularity in a different context. Inteha’s first CD is currently underway with many more ground breaking singles and videos to follow.
